The Allure of the Chanel J12:
The J12, launched in 2000, revolutionized the watchmaking landscape. Its high-tech ceramic construction, a material rarely used in luxury watches at the time, immediately set it apart. The high-gloss black or white ceramic offered a striking contrast to traditional metals, presenting a futuristic aesthetic that resonated with a new generation of watch enthusiasts. This bold departure from established norms, coupled with Chanel's inherent association with high fashion and timeless style, resulted in an instant classic. The J12’s success lies in its ability to seamlessly blend sporty functionality with sophisticated elegance, appealing to a broad spectrum of tastes. Its clean lines, minimalist dial, and distinctive bezel create a versatile timepiece suitable for both formal occasions and everyday wear.

The Chanel J12 Chromatic H3099: A Closer Look
The specific model under consideration, the Chanel J12 Chromatic H3099, represents a refined iteration of the iconic design. Listed at $2,203, this pre-owned timepiece offers a compelling entry point into the world of high-end luxury watches. Its key features include:
* Reference Number: H3099 – This number serves as a unique identifier for this specific model, allowing for easy verification and authentication.
* Material: High-tech ceramic and titanium. This combination offers a lightweight yet durable construction, showcasing Chanel's commitment to innovative materials and exceptional quality. Titanium's hypoallergenic properties add to its appeal.
* Movement: Automatic. The automatic movement ensures reliable timekeeping without the need for manual winding, adding to the watch's practicality and convenience.
* Complication: GMT (Greenwich Mean Time) and Calendar. The addition of a GMT function enhances the watch's versatility, making it ideal for frequent travelers. The calendar function provides added practicality for everyday use.
* Dial: Grey. The grey dial offers a subtle yet sophisticated contrast to the black or white ceramic cases typically associated with the J12, providing a unique aesthetic.
